Welcome back!

A few changes:
- of course, we moved
- our weeknights are Tuesday and Thursday
- most weekend time is Saturday

The Power Wheels car is our biggest group project. Others still pop up periodically. Probably our biggest "thing" otherwise is outreach. We have a booth at about 4-5 regular annual events now, not counting the KC Maker Faire. We also work on our own Omaha Mini Maker Faire.

Benson and Dundee are good neighborhoods. The Blackstine district (Farnham between around 35th to 40th) is really hopping. You can definitely get good value for your money in CB. And there has been huge growth in the areas south of Omaha (Ralston, Bellevue, Gretna, etc) and out west.

I don't know about internet. I assume it's fast everywhere. But I'm also biased towards Cox (free service will do that to you), so I haven't really "shopped around" for it.

We'll be glad to have you back!

I'm satisfied enough with Council Bluffs that I actually moved to a different house in CB earlier this year.  I benefit from cheap property and vehicle taxes, and the city has enough money to properly plow our streets.  On the other hand, I pay income tax in two states and my friends all make fun of me for living in CB.  If you do look at houses here, as a general guideline, you want to live in a hilly neighborhood where the streets aren't on a grid.  Although I've shopped around quite a bit in the past, I can't really speak to housing in other areas right now.

Cox is the best internet for most of the city.  Once you pick a place to live, it might be worth checking what service CenturyLink offers there, as it could be either faster or more cost-effective, although I'm not sure their customer service is as good.

Omaha as a whole hasn't changed much that I've noticed, although it's hard to observe slow change.  I'll be curious to hear your take on it.

The Makery, on the other hand, has changed a ton (for the better).  You'll be impressed.
